It's supposed to support 3.16, as per the metadata at least. If
something's changed in gnome-shell, I wouldn't know what. The extensions
aren't using a well-defined API -- it's more of a "rummage through
internal structures" model.

I'd take a look in ~/.local/share/gnome-shell/extensions/ and move away
everything that's broken/not in use, then file a bug against the
extension if it doesn't start working.
